Matthew 28:20 teaching them to observe all things that I have commanded you; and lo, I am with you always, even to the end of the age.” Amen.

Imagine telling someone that you are going to be with them forever.

Now you may think this is something we will all say when we get married or express our love for another; but living that truth is something different.

We can do our best to be there and love and support, but when it comes down to it, we fail at some stage. Not because we want to fail, but because we are human and we do fail.

God does not have that problem! The Holy Spirit will be and is with us from the moment we invite Him in! Awesome or what!

2 Timothy 4:22 The Lord Jesus Christ be with your spirit. Grace be with you. Amen.

Have you ever wondered why this should talk about the Lord being with our spirit?

When Christ changes us, He changes our spirit. Our souls are us, the part of us that defines us through our minds, emotions and will.

God changes the part of us that defines our relationship with Him; if we have God with our spirits, we are a new being because God cannot accept sin.

This does not mean we stop sinning because we still sin through our souls even if the spirit has been changed.

Mark 2:27 Then he said to them, ‘The Sabbath was made for man, not man for the Sabbath.

God made the Sabbath for us and for a reason. He did not have some spare time to take a day off; God started the Sabbath for our good.

Working your socks off to try and make a success of your business or to earn more money is not going to be good for your health; it may fill your pockets but at the cost of your wellbeing!

God knows this and so made the Sabbath so we would take time off to be closer to Him. He did not make it just so we would take time off but so we would enjoy our time off with Him!

Luke 13:15 The Lord then answered him and said, “Hypocrite! Does not each one of you on the Sabbath loose his ox or donkey from the stall, and lead it away to water it?

Where do you draw the line about what you do or do not do on your day or rest? I know many church leaders cannot rest on Sundays because they are so busy with organising services and things so they should be taking another day off somewhere.

God has given us 6 days in which to do what needs to be done with another day as a day of rest. But that does not mean life coming to an end every week!

We need to continue living and allowing people to see that we love God and serve Him, even on our day of rest.
